What it is
A standalone connector for Actual Budget, the open-source budgeting app that builders favor as a private alternative to the big-name money apps. It lets an AI assistant read your accounts, transactions, and spending, so you can just ask.
What it does for you
You get answers about your money in plain language. "What did we spend on software this year?" or "which categories are creeping up?" become questions you ask, not reports you assemble by hand.
What you'll need
You need to already run Actual Budget somewhere, either a local file or a server, plus a way to run the small connector. Both Actual Budget and the connector are free and open source, so there's no subscription here.
